What's Newįirefox Beta gets updated several times per week and as a consequence, the release notes for the Beta channel are updated continuously to reflect features that have reached sufficient maturity to benefit from community feedback and bug reports. This Beta includes performance enhancements that improve the browsing experience for users and enable developers to create faster web apps and websites.

The latest Mozilla Firefox Beta is now available for testing on Windows, Mac, Linux and Android. The non-profit organization has promised to push out a new stable build every six weeks. Mozilla has switched Firefox to a rapid release development cycle which means new versions will come more frequently.
